Siberian Tea Herb Information

Latin name : Bergenia Ligulata

English/Common name : Siberian tea

Indian name : Pather churi, Pakhanbed

Family : Saxifragaceae

Part used : Rhizome (root)

Properties

Root is Diuretic demulcent, and Astringent, Dissolves gravel and stone in the bladder. It is a perennial climbing plant that grows well in moist and shady hilly areas, especially in the foothills of the Himalayas and the Khasi hills of Assam. The stems are short and thick and the leaves ovate and bright red seasonally. The flowers are white, pink or purple.

It is a Diuretic traditionally used to promote optimum urinary tract health. It supports the bladder and helps maintain an adequate crystalloid - colloid balance that keeps Calcium salts in solution.

The Antilithic property of the extract has been investigated and concluded that the extract had no effect in preventing stone formation but was of significant help in dissolving preformed stones. Promote Diuresis, anti-inflammatory. In Ayurvedic practice, Pakhanbed, as its name suggests, is used as a Litholytic agent for urinary Calculi. It is widely used in the treatment of Dysuria and renal failure, cystitis and Crystalluria. Its anti-inflammatory property finds a use in the treatment of abscesses and Cutaneous infections. It is also used in the treatment of Dysentery and Diarrhoea.
